These days, more and more people are working from home. Watch this video to learn vocabulary and phrases related to homeworking. I’ll also talk about the social context of Generation Y and millennials in English-speaking countries, and why it has led to more people working from home. We will talk about shifting values, the role of men in the family, and much more. In the second part of the class, I’ll give you some sample sentences you can use to talk to your boss about working from home some or all of the time. By the way, this video was filmed before the pandemic. I know many more people are working from home now, even if they don’t want to!
